Step 6: Cold-start hardening for the Quarrow serverless handlers. Pre-warm pool set to 4; init code moved outside the handler to cut latency. Review the init path — it reads config once per container, so stale values persist until recycle. No secrets in logs; verified. The env file needs the signing credential the warm-up probe uses, appended on the line immediately after this sentence.

env line for fafof-fahag: LEDGER_TOKEN5=f8790

This alert fires when the Skylark fare experiment's treatment arm diverges from control by more than 12% in realized ticket price over a rolling hour. It usually means the experiment config was pushed with a stale multiplier, or the holdout group was accidentally enrolled. Do not pause the experiment yourself — that invalidates the analysis window. Instead, confirm the divergence in the metrics dashboard and escalate to the pricing lead. Escalation steps and arm definitions are listed on the internal experiments page.

dashboard of bafof-hafog = https://confluence.lumiclabs.internal/display/browse/display/6a09a20a

- [ ] **Step 7: Breaker override escrow.** After sealing the signing keys for the Tallgrove upstream API circuit breaker, confirm the support team can force the breaker open during a full outage. The override bundle lives in the sealed escrow drawer and is useless without its unlock phrase. Two ceremony witnesses must initial this step before proceeding. The escrow bundle is decrypted with the recovery passphrase that follows.

vault phrase of kahip-kahop = holath-quenmir